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6149104289 1933 7734 47176176779 9499563
687 0757919136 6681833706
687 0757919136 6681833706
51 795457 9497429
All about undefined
Interested in learning more?
687 0757919136 6681833706
51 795457 9497429
See more
407296779 6875842072 128387
7868398022 273 3943
See more
4138531 66423193 4158566475
50739952758 86113353 71432
See more